FM Preview: Peterhead v East Stirlingshire 14 Jan 2012

Last updated : 13 January 2012 By Footymad Previewer

Footymad preview History of the Peterhead v East Stirlingshire fixture

Peterhead prepare to entertain East Stirlingshire at Balmoor Stadium on Saturday afternoon, aiming to maintain a near-perfect record against their opponents. The Blue Toon have tasted victory on 10 of the 12 occasions the teams have met.

The most recent encounter between these two sides at Balmoor Stadium was just last season, in August 2010, with Peterhead annihilating their visitors 6-1 in a Scottish Challenge Cup match.

Recent respective form guides

Peterhead are not in the best of form at home, with two wins, two draws, and two defeats in their last six. A generous 7 goals have been both scored and conceded in this period.

The away form of East Stirlingshire is pretty dire, collecting just 1 solitary point from the last six. Shire have conceded 19 goals in these games, and only hit 3 in reply.

Peterhead are hovering perilously just above the relegation zone, with 13 points from 17 matches.

East Stirlingshire find themselves stuck right at the bottom of the division. Their 19 games have yielded only 9 points.
